About Simpson County Clerk's Office

The Simpson County Clerk's Office, located in Franklin, Kentucky, is a DMV office that provides various services to the public, including vehicle registration, title transfers, and driver's license renewals. The office is situated at 103 West Cedar Street, Franklin, KY 42134, and can be reached by phone at 270-586-8161. The office is committed to providing efficient and friendly service to the community.
